Military Software Reliability Allocation

The reliability allocation techniques that got developed in recent years are an important method to ensure the quality of software and to enhance the reliability of it. They are applied in various stages of software engineering, and the effective reliability allocation in the plan and design stages is the crucial step to complete the software design work.In this article, the author has chosen the reliability allocation method based on module complexity and module importance. The purpose is to make the reliability allocation in the development of military software more reasonable and more practical. In order to suit to the characteristics of The Communications Control System , reliability allocation is studied, relevant module complexity and module importance are calculated. Allocation of reliability is given in two cases. In the first case, module importance is considered, while in the second case, both module complexity and module importance are considered. In addition, further exploration is made on the influence of minute variation of module complexity upon the result of allocation. Ideal result is achieved in this respect.This essay provides a useful experiment on the reliability allocation of military software and will ensure promising utility value in the research of reliability allocation of military software.
